+Fix gcc-6 -Werror=misleading-indentation errors
+
+Patch did not apply cleanly, so re-create the same changes.
+Also fixed some whitespace errors not addressed in the original patch.
+
+Upstream-Status: Backport
+Signed-off-by: Tim Orling <timothy.t.orling@linux.intel.com>
+
+From: Michel Normand <normand@linux.vnet.ibm.com>
+Subject: nss gcc6 change
+Date: Mon, 18 Apr 2016 19:11:03 +0200
+
+nss changes required to avoid build error with gcc6 like:
+===
+[ 58s] h_page.c: In function 'new_lseek':
+[ 58s] h_page.c:117:8: error: this 'if' clause does not guard... [-Werror=misleading-indentation]
+[ 58s] if(offset < 1)
+[ 58s] ^~
+[ 58s] h_page.c:120:3: note: ...this statement, but the latter is misleadingly indented as if it is guarded by the 'if'
+[ 58s] cur_pos = lseek(fd, 0, SEEK_CUR);
+[ 58s] ^~~~~~~
+===
